White House Criticizes Amazon for Showing Tariff Costs on Product Prices

Amazon is reportedly planning to display the cost of tariffs directly next to the total price of products on its platform. This move aims to increase transparency for consumers about how tariffs affect product pricing. However, the White House has criticized this decision, labeling it as a "hostile and political act."

White House Press Secretary Karoline Leavitt accused Amazon of partnering with what she described as a "Chinese propaganda arm," suggesting political motivations behind the transparency move. This statement came shortly after a report by Punchbowl News revealed Amazon's plan to highlight tariff fees alongside product prices.

The context for this controversy is the ongoing impact of tariffs imposed during the Trump administration, which have affected retailers worldwide. Many sellers on Amazon have raised prices or opted out of major sales events like Prime Day due to increased costs. Other companies, such as Volkswagen, have also added import fees to their products to offset tariffs.

Low-cost retailers like Shein and Temu have similarly raised prices in response to tariffs, reflecting a broader trend of cost increases passed on to consumers. This situation illustrates the complex interplay between trade policies, corporate pricing strategies, and consumer transparency.

Implications for E-commerce and Global Trade

Amazon's decision to show tariff costs directly on product listings could set a precedent for greater pricing transparency in e-commerce. For consumers, this means clearer understanding of how trade policies affect the final price they pay. For sellers and retailers, it introduces new considerations in pricing strategies and communication with customers.

However, the political backlash from government officials highlights the sensitivity around trade issues and the role of major platforms in shaping public perception. This dynamic underscores the importance for businesses to navigate geopolitical factors carefully while maintaining transparency and trust with customers.
